The Anthem 2020 " Ballet " paint scheme is a return to a similar " Beachstone " paint scheme offered in 15, 16 and a few very early 17's. We chose the Beachstone paint after having a Black upper paint scheme on our Allegro Bus and found exterior wall temperatures varied in excess of 30 degrees between the Black vs the lighter colors. The same is true on our Anthem. Exactly what that temperature variation translates to in transferring to the interior I have never attempted to figure out but we have noticed less run time on our AC's which we understand is also a better insulation package.
2020 Anthem has no steerable tag.

We traded our ‘16 Anthem on a ‘20 Anthem and sounds like ours was the first coach to roll out with the new Ballet paint scheme. We picked it up late April and drove to Homecoming. We had discussions with Pat and some of the other engineering folks about the actual colors vs. the website colors. They are definitely aware of the problem and are working on improving it.
As for the new ride, IT IS FABULOUS!!! So smooth, floats going down the highway much better than the ‘16. The EZ steer is a feature I really questioned the need for, but I totally missed that one! The EZ Steer is a great feature in wind!This new coach is an extremely nice improvement over a coach that we were already quite happy with! This new coach and the new Ballet color are truly a great result of owner input and Entegra listening. We were one of the big howlers about the dark colors and are thrilled with the new Ballet, the new smoother ride, the new EZ Steer, and the great quality!
